Fiber optic technology is the invisible infrastructure behind the modern world — carrying internet traffic, telephone calls, television signals, and high-speed data across continents at the speed of light. This course provides a focused, structured, and accessible introduction to the fundamental principles behind how fiber optic communication systems work.
Covering seven carefully selected sections, Fiber Optics Communications Fundamentals is designed for students, engineers, and technology professionals who want a solid theoretical grounding in the science and architecture of fiber optic systems — without requiring advanced prior knowledge.
What this course covers
The course opens with the history of optical communication — tracing how the concept of transmitting information using light evolved from early experiments through to the sophisticated global networks that power the internet today. You will then move into a thorough introduction to optical fiber itself — its structure, composition, and the different fiber types used across different applications and environments.
From there, the course explores the relationship between optical fiber and light — covering total internal reflection, ray theory, modes of propagation, and the physical principles that make fiber optic transmission possible. These foundations lead directly into a system-level study of the complete fiber optic communication system — understanding how transmitters, optical channels, and receivers work together to carry signals reliably over long distances.
A dedicated section on the properties of optical fiber examines the performance characteristics that determine how a fiber behaves in service — including attenuation, dispersion, bandwidth, and numerical aperture. The course then turns to the active components at the heart of any fiber optic system. Optical sources — including LEDs, Fabry-Perot lasers, DFB lasers, and VCSELs — are examined in terms of how they generate and launch light into fiber, and how their characteristics affect system performance. The course concludes with optical detectors, explaining how light signals are converted back into electrical signals at the receiver and what factors govern detection performance.
By the end of this course, you will have a well-rounded understanding of fiber optic communications — the theory, the physics, the system architecture, and the key components — ready for further study, professional development, or direct application in the field.
